No, his last appearance was on All-Stars and that was in 2004. His tax evasion didn't come to light until a couple of years later and even then he didn't initially say it was a payoff to keep quiet; he first presented it as a misunderstanding about who would pay the taxes. The story was so ludicrous that no one believed it so he kept enhancing it until finally he said it was a payoff. Probst said he was considered for Heroes vs. Villains, but he was still on probation and couldn't leave the country. Since then he's ramped up the anti-Survivor comments, especially after they cast Wiglesworth on Second Chance.

Dang, I thought that the tax evasion stuff had hit before All Stars, my bad. Why would it take the government that long to prosecute?

They probably gave him several chances to file an amended return and pay the taxes and he didn't. In a normal case, it takes at least a couple of years for the IRS to even discover the return doesn't match the 1099s and then they give you every chance to fix it so they don't have to prosecute. I once left an amount off my return by mistake but I never heard from the IRS; I discovered it myself over a year later and filed an amended return then. Of course, that was only, like, $900, not a million. I don't know how he didn't figure he'd get caught since he made a huge amount of money in the most public way possible.
